THIS IS THE FINEST RIFLE IN MY CUSTOM GUN COLLECTION - A HARRY LAWSON SPECTACULAR EXHIBITION GRADE CUSTOM RIFLE IN 416 TAYLOR CALIBER.

THE WOOD ALONE IS WORTH $6,000.

This Spectacular custom hunting rifle has a 24″ medium weight barrel with ramp Gold Bead Front sight, and a fully adjustable rear sight. The muzzle is Mag-na-ported. The receiver is drilled & tapped for scope bases. The bolt body & extractor are finely jeweled. Custom trigger has a crossbolt safety. Stock is Exhiibition Grade Burled, Honey & Chocolate Circassian Walnut with Rosewood forend tip and Rosewood Sweeping grip cap. Stock has a long sweeping rollover cheekpiece and a white line waffle recoil pad. The forestock and wrist are beautifully checkered & carved in oak leaf patterns with a double arrowhead 2-color wood inlay in bottom of forestock. This spectacular stock work has all the earmarks of having been done by Nils Hultgren. 13-5/8" LOP - 8 lbs 9 oz - Overall condition is Extremely fine plus and remains very little unfired retaining virtually all of its custom brilliant blue on metal and high gloss finish on wood. Brilliant shiny bore.
